TR-1A belongs to the second generation of the smallest ADS-B transceivers on market and has been developed for civil and commercial Unmanned Aircraft Systems (weight and size reduced by 33%). The device operates on 1090MHz and allows receiving and transmitting ADS-B data with defined 0.25, 0.5 or 1 Watt output power.
